What materials do I need to build a Minecraft car?

To build a Minecraft car, you will need a variety of materials, including blocks, items, and redstone components. The specific materials required will depend on the design and features of your car. Some common materials used in Minecraft car builds include obsidian, quartz, or black wool for the body, glowstone or sea lanterns for headlights, and redstone torches and repeaters for the engine and other mechanisms. You may also want to use glass or ice for windows, and slime blocks or honey blocks for a more advanced suspension system.

In addition to these materials, you will also need a pickaxe, a shovel, and other basic tools to gather resources and build your car. If you want to add more complex features, such as a working steering system or a speedometer, you may need to use additional redstone components, such as pistons, sticky pistons, and observers. Make sure to plan your design carefully and gather all the necessary materials before starting your build.
